Position Summary
The Seasonal People Operations Coordinator at Highway West Vacations supports high-volume HR, onboarding, payroll, and employee administration activities during peak operational periods. This role serves as a key resource for seasonal employees and managers by coordinating hiring and onboarding processes, maintaining employee records, supporting payroll and timekeeping functions, and helping ensure compliance with company policies and employment regulations. The ideal candidate is highly organized, adaptable, and able to thrive in a fast-paced, seasonal environment with changing workforce demands.
Key Responsibilities / Essential Functions
-
Coordinate seasonal new hire onboarding, employment documentation, and employment status changes; accurately enter and maintain employee information in HRIS and payroll systems.
-
Support high-volume hiring initiatives by managing onboarding communications, scheduling orientation activities, and ensuring timely completion of required paperwork.
-
Maintain confidential employee records, both electronic and paper, in accordance with company policies and applicable regulations.
-
Track employee attendance, timekeeping records, leave balances, and other workforce data to support accurate payroll processing.
-
Partner with site managers to ensure timely payroll submissions and employee data updates throughout the season.
-
Serve as a primary point of contact for seasonal employees and supervisors, responding to HR, payroll, and policy-related questions.
-
Coordinate onboarding communications and employee engagement activities to support a positive employee experience during the employment lifecycle.
-
Assist with workers' compensation claim documentation and administrative coordination within the assigned region.
-
Support employee relations matters by documenting concerns, facilitating follow-up actions, and escalating issues to People Operations leadership as appropriate.
-
Conduct exit interviews and offboarding activities for seasonal and temporary employees, as requested.
-
Generate reports, conduct audits, and review HR/payroll data to ensure accuracy and compliance.
-
Assist with workforce planning, staffing transitions, and end-of-season employment administration.
